Medacta International provides a comprehensive educational program for surgeons to master the Anterior Minimally Invasive Surgery (AMIS) technique for hip arthroplasty. The program aims to reduce the learning curve and enhance surgical outcomes through structured training and support.

AMIS Education Program
  • Instructional Level: This level includes a visit to an AMIS Reference Center, participation in an AMIS Learning Center for hands-on cadaver training, and support from a Reference Surgeon during initial surgeries.
  • Advanced Level: Focuses on scientific discussions to improve technique and expand patient selection.
  • Master Level: Offers cadaver workshops for complex cases and revision surgeries, with expert discussions on the strengths and limitations of the AMIS approach.

GASTON Flexible Pneumatic Arm
The GASTON arm is a surgical aid designed to assist surgeons by holding instruments securely during procedures. It is easy to manipulate and stable once positioned, featuring a 90 cm multi-articulated arm capable of supporting up to 5 kg.

Key Features
  • Single-use sterile multifunction hook and sleeve to reduce infection risks and ensure readiness.
  • Ergonomic design for ease of use and repositioning during surgery.
  • Made from 50% glass-fiber reinforced polyarylamide for durability.

AMIS & MEDACTA: LEADERS IN ANTERIOR APPROACH EDUCATION A TESTED AND PROVEN METHOD OF CONTINUING EDUCATION Minimally Invasive Hip Surgery is a very difficult technique to adapt to, and may present a surgeon with a steep learning curve when performing their initial cases. This learning curve has discouraged some surgeons and led them to abandon minimally invasive procedures for other techniques. With lessons learned, the primary mission of Medacta is to minimise the frustrations and concerns of an orthopaedic surgeon by providing unprecedented educational and clinical support when starting with our anterior hip program, AMIS. The M.O.R.E. AMIS Education Program has been developed to help you master the AMIS approach, starting from the easiest primary hip arthroplasties up to the most complex revisions. INSTRUCTIONAL LEVEL: HOW TO START WITH AMIS This level involves the following steps: ■ 1ST STEP: AMIS REFERENCE CENTER VISIT In several countries, you will have the opportunity to visit a Reference Center and to assist during an AMIS surgery. ■ 2ND STEP: AMIS LEARNING CENTER You will have the opportunity to operate on cadaver specimens with the assistance of teaching surgeons, to experience the advantages of the AMIS Mobile Leg Positioner, to analyse difficult cases, and have a thorough overview of the indications and contraindications of anterior approach. ■ 3RD STEP: SUPPORT FOR THE FIRST AMIS SURGERIES You will receive the assistance of a Reference Surgeon for your first surgeries in your hospital. ADVANCED LEVEL: HOW TO IMPROVE THE AMIS TECHNIQUE AND WIDEN THE PATIENT SELECTION The Advanced Learning Center focuses on detailed scientific topics that stimulate expert-to-expert open discussion, increase AMIS confidence and widen the patient selection for almost all primary cases. MASTER LEVEL: HOW TO MASTER THE AMIS TECHNIQUE, FOCUSING ON DIFFICULT CASES AND REVISIONS The Revision AMIS Learning Center offers the opportunity to experience a cadaver workshop that includes a variety of strategies to help fracture management, along with your chance to operate on complex revision arthroplasties. Strengths and limitations of the AMIS approach in revision surgeries are analysed and discussed with international high-level experts. Participating in this tried and tested program should not only help you to avoid any early complications and minimise your learning curve, but also offer you some important “pearls” to assist you during your first cases. GASTON is a flexible pneumatic arm created to offer the surgeon valuable aid throughout a surgical procedure. SINGLE-USE STERILE MULTIFUNCTION HOOK AND SLEEVE Gaston sterile instruments, multifunction hook and protective sleeve, are supplied together as single use devices and offer the following benefits: ■ Potential reduction of the risk of non-sterile instrument occurrences (estimated cost for a single surgical site infection in USA has been $25,500)[1]; ■ Potential reduction of surgery cancellation or delay: they are always ready, sterile and brand new; ■ Removal of wear and tear risks.
